i get an extremely weird error when ever i go to this page for the first time during a session

 

Warning: Unknown(): Your script possibly relies on a session side-effect which existed until PHP 4.2.3. Please be advised that the session extension does not consider global variables as a source of data, unless register_globals is enabled. You can disable this functionality and this warning by setting session.bug_compat_42 or session.bug_compat_warn to off, respectively. in Unknown on line 0

 

i even disabled session.bug_compact_42 to off in the php.ini file

im confused

anyone know what to do about this?

Link to comment
Share on other sites

fortunately i thought it over again and made a new php.ini file in the directory im in, and then instead of setting each off the settings to = 2 i made it so they = Off

and no i don't get the error
